Beer Water Content: 6+ Facts You Need to Know

how much water in beer

Beer Water Content: 6+ Facts You Need to Know

Water constitutes the overwhelming majority of beer’s quantity, sometimes comprising 90-95%. This important ingredient acts as a solvent for sugars, minerals, and different compounds derived from the malt and different brewing adjuncts. It additionally performs an important position in mashing, lautering, and sparging processes, influencing the ultimate product’s taste profile.

The exact quantity and high quality considerably affect the ultimate product. Utilizing pure, clear water is important for optimum brewing. Traditionally, brewers relied on domestically accessible water sources, which regularly contributed distinctive mineral profiles and straight impacted the beer’s traits. Sure types, like Pilsners, are historically related to comfortable water, whereas others, resembling Burton ales, profit from laborious water wealthy in minerals.

1/6 Keg Beer Prices: How Much + Cost Factors

how much is a 1 6 keg of beer

1/6 Keg Beer Prices: How Much + Cost Factors

A “1/6 keg” refers to a sixth-barrel keg of beer, also called a “sixtel.” This container usually holds roughly 5.17 gallons of beer, equal to roughly 55 twelve-ounce servings. It gives a handy possibility for smaller gatherings or events the place a full-size keg, or half-barrel, is perhaps extreme.

The capability of this measurement keg provides a steadiness between quantity and manageability. It gives enough beer for a reasonable variety of friends, decreasing the danger of spoilage and waste. The comparatively smaller measurement additionally permits for simpler storage and transportation in comparison with bigger keg choices. Traditionally, standardized keg sizes just like the sixth-barrel arose from the necessity for constant measurement and pricing throughout the brewing business.

Cost of 1/6 Keg of Beer: 7+ Prices

how much is 1 6 keg of beer

Cost of 1/6 Keg of Beer: 7+ Prices

A “sixth barrel” keg, sometimes called a “sixtel,” comprises roughly 5.16 gallons of beer, equal to 58.65 12-ounce servings. This keg measurement has turn out to be more and more well-liked resulting from its manageable measurement and weight, making it a sensible alternative for smaller gatherings, eating places with restricted storage, and conditions the place selection is desired.

The emergence of the sixth barrel keg addresses the wants of a altering market. Traditionally, bigger keg sizes like half-barrels (15.5 gallons) have been customary. Nevertheless, with the rising demand for numerous craft beers and the will to attenuate waste, the smaller sixth barrel affords a sensible answer. This measurement permits institutions to supply a wider number of beers on faucet with out the dedication and potential spoilage related to bigger kegs. It additionally empowers shoppers internet hosting smaller occasions to supply draft beer with out extreme leftover quantity.
